Full job description

MULTIPLE POSITIONS OPEN!

We are looking for multiple casual Disability Support Workers in Sydney. You will work directly with NDIS participants in their homes and/or in the community. You will support participants to achieve their individual goals, develop everyday living skills, participate in meaningful activities, and maintain greater independence. Support will be tailored to each participant’s needs, preferences, abilities, support plan, and NDIS goals.

Key Responsibilities

Your duties may include:

  • Supporting participants to access the community and participate in social, recreational, educational, and capacity-building activities
  • Accompanying participants to appointments, community facilities, shopping centres, events, and other activities
  • Providing transport to and from activities or appointments
  • Supporting participants to develop independence, confidence, communication, and social skills
  • Assisting with daily living activities within the participant’s home including meal preparation, household tasks, cleaning, laundry, shopping, and general home organisation
  • Providing prompting or assistance with personal routines where required and within the worker’s training and responsibilities
  • Following participant support plans, risk assessments, behaviour support plans, and workplace procedures
  • Monitoring participant wellbeing and reporting any changes, concerns, hazards, or incidents
  • Completing accurate shift notes, progress notes, incident reports, and other required documentation
  • Maintaining professional boundaries and protecting participant privacy and confidentiality
  • Communicating respectfully with participants, families, guardians, support coordinators, and other relevant stakeholders

Essential Requirements

Applicants must have, or be willing to obtain:

  • A valid Australian driver’s licence
  • Access to a reliable and insured vehicle
  • NDIS Worker Screening Check
  • Working with Children Check
  • Current First Aid and CPR Certificate
  • NDIS Worker Orientation Module certificate
  • Full working rights in Australia

Relevant qualifications in Individual Support, Disability, Community Services, Nursing, Allied Health, Social Work, Psychology, or a related field will be highly regarded.
